Job summary

Armanino LLP seeks a seasoned tax professional to lead complex personal and fiduciary tax engagements for high-net-worth clients, including pass-through entities, trusts, estates, and gift tax matters.

You will supervise engagements, mentor staff, review technical matters, and coordinate with IRS audits while staying current on tax law changes and providing training to the team.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Accounting, Tax, Finance, or related discipline.
  • Qualified to practice before the IRS (i.e., JD, CPA, or EA).
  • Minimum of 6 years’ experience in public accounting in taxation or equivalent experience.
  • Minimum of 2 years in a managerial role involving clients and team members.
  • Possess a strong knowledge of accounting theory and federal, state and local tax laws.

Responsibilities

  • Perform technical reviews of tax returns for high-net-worth individuals, primarily their personal income tax returns as well as their closely held businesses (pass through entities), trust, estate, and gift tax returns.
  • Provide consultation on business and/or personal transactions (if applicable), and the related tax implications, consequences and treatment
  • Develop responses to IRS and other regulatory and tax authorities’ audits, notices and inquiries
  • Manage larger and complex engagements and workflow of multiple clients and related deliverables to minimize risk and surprises, maximize engagement economics, meet internal and external deadlines and develops less experienced engagement personnel, primarily managers and supervisors
  • Review or conduct high level research of complex or emerging tax issues and prepare memorandums to support conclusions
  • Identify assignment resource requirements and ensure the most appropriate resources are assigned to specific assignment roles
  • Continually build on technical expertise in taxation by attending continuing professional education courses or utilizing other training resource
  • Keep current with tax law changes and provide updates and training to the firm’s tax practice members
  • Train and develop less experienced individuals responsible for engagement management responsibilities, including managing budgets, scheduling and staffing, due date management and client relations

Armanino is the brand name under which Armanino LLP and Armanino Advisory LLC, independently owned entities, provide professional services in an alternative practice structure in accordance with law, regulations, and professional standards. Armanino LLP is a licensed independent CPA firm that provides attest services, and Armanino Advisory LLC and its subsidiary entities provide tax, advisory, and business consulting services. Armanino Advisory LLC and its subsidiary entities are not licensed CPA firms.
